    Using Assessments to Support Math Instruction & Build Mathematical Vocabulary
    Effective mathematics instruction is driven by meaningful assessment and intentional language development. In this session, participants will explore how assessment practices can be used to identify student strengths and learning needs while also developing students' mathematical vocabulary and academic discourse. 
    Target Audience
    Math teachers
    Learner Outcomes
  • Participants will be able to use assessment evidence to make informed instructional decisions that address students' strengths and learning needs.
  • Participants will be able to implement instructional strategies that build mathematical vocabulary and promote meaningful mathematical discourse in the classroom.
